Frequently Asked Questions about Seattle

How much are Studio apartments in Seattle?

There are currently 3,492 Studio Apartments in Seattle with rent ranges from $594 to $4,657 with an average price of $1,651.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Seattle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Seattle ranges from $634 to $9,830 with an average monthly rent of $2,303.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Seattle c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Seattle range from $950 to $18,095.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,135.

How expensive are Seattle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 854 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Seattle on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$900 to $23,969 - averaging $4,170 for the location.
